π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

13 items
  • 2 pounds chicken wings
  • 0.3333 cup soy sauce
  • 0.25 cup honey
  • 2 tablespoons hoisin s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 2 teaspoons minced garlic
  • 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on sriracha (optional for heat)
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on sesame seeds
  • 2 stalks green onions, thinly sliced (for garnish)
  • as needed cooking spray or oil

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 400Β°F (200Β°C) and line a large baking sheet with aluminum foil for easy cleanup. Place a wire rack on top of the baking sheet and lightly spray it with cooking spray or oil.

2

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, honey, hoisin sauce, sesame oil, garlic, ginger, rice vinegar, sriracha (if using), and black pepper.

3

Pat the chicken wings dry with paper towels to help them crisp up in the oven. Add the wings to the bowl with the marinade and toss until they are well coated. Let them marinate for at least 15 minutes, or cover and refrigerate for up to 2 hours for more flavor.

4

Arrange the chicken wings in a single layer on the prepared wire rack, making sure they are not touching or overlapping. Reserve the remaining marinade.

5

Roast the wings in the preheated oven for 25 minutes. Remove from the oven, brush with the reserved marinade, and flip the wings to the other side. Brush this side with more marinade.

6

Return the wings to the oven and roast for another 20 minutes, or until they are golden brown, slightly charred, and cooked through (internal temperature of 165Β°F or 74Β°C).

7

Optional: For extra caramelization, turn on the broiler for the last 2-3 minutes of cooking, keeping a close eye to avoid burning.

8

Remove the wings from the oven and let them rest for 5 minutes. Sprinkle with sesame seeds and garnish with sliced green onions before serving.

9

Enjoy your Roasted Asian Chicken Wings as an appetizer, snack, or part of a meal!
